WebJul 1, 2024 · A post-hoc subanalysis of this study found that BNP was a weaker predictor in subjects > 70 years of age. BNP levels tended to be higher in elderly subjects, and this decreased the specificity for any given cutpoint. Several smaller studies subsequently found that BNP remained useful in elderly patients, though higher cut-points were needed. crossword gestation sites

WebWhen measured early after the onset of acute pulmonary edema, a BNP level of <250 pg/mL supports the diagnosis of acute lung injury. The high rate of cardiac and renal dysfunction in critically ill patients limits the discriminative role of BNP. WebDec 3, 2002 · BNP in Acute Coronary Syndromes. After the description of BNP elevation in patients with chronic heart failure, several investigations focused on the clinical implications of neurohormonal activation after acute myocardial infarction (MI).
